Facebook pixel
>Blog>Ciência de Dados
Ciência de Dados

10 Projetos Em Python para Iniciantes Aprenderem e Praticarem

Neste artigo, vamos abordar os primeiros passos para começar a programar em Python e os benefícios de aprender através de projetos.

Primeiros passos para começar a programar em Python

Aqui estão algumas dicas para ajudá-lo a dar os primeiros passos na programação em Python:

1. Instale o Python

Antes de começar, certifique-se de ter o Python instalado em seu computador. Você pode baixar a versão mais recente do Python no site oficial e seguir as instruções de instalação.

2. Ambiente de desenvolvimento

Escolha um ambiente de desenvolvimento integrado (IDE) para escrever seu código Python. Existem várias opções disponíveis, como o PyCharm, o Visual Studio Code e o Jupyter Notebook. Escolha aquele que melhor se adapta às suas necessidades e preferências.

3. Aprenda os fundamentos

Antes de mergulhar em projetos mais complexos, é importante ter uma compreensão sólida dos fundamentos da linguagem Python. Estude conceitos como variáveis, estruturas de controle (como loops e condicionais), funções e listas. Existem muitos recursos online, como tutoriais em vídeo e documentação oficial, que podem ajudá-lo nesse processo.

4. Pratique com exercícios simples

À medida que você aprende os conceitos básicos, pratique-os através de exercícios simples. Crie pequenos programas para resolver problemas simples, como calcular a média de uma lista de números ou imprimir os números pares de 1 a 100. A prática constante é fundamental para aprimorar suas habilidades de programação.

Benefícios de aprender Python através de projetos

Aprender Python através de projetos práticos é uma forma eficaz e divertida de dominar a linguagem. Aqui estão alguns benefícios de aprender Python dessa maneira:

1. Aprendizado prático

Ao desenvolver projetos em Python, você terá a oportunidade de aplicar os conceitos teóricos que aprendeu na prática. Isso ajudará a consolidar seu conhecimento e a entender como a linguagem funciona em situações reais.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

2. Motivação

Aprender Python através de projetos pode ser muito motivador. À medida que você desenvolve projetos e vê os resultados concretos do seu trabalho, sentirá uma sensação de realização e motivação para continuar aprendendo e aprimorando suas habilidades.

3. Aplicação em áreas específicas

Python é uma linguagem versátil que pode ser aplicada em diversas áreas, como desenvolvimento web, análise de dados, inteligência artificial e automação de tarefas. Ao desenvolver projetos nessas áreas, você estará adquirindo habilidades relevantes e aumentando suas chances de encontrar oportunidades profissionais.

4. Desenvolvimento de portfólio

Ao criar projetos em Python, você estará construindo um portfólio de trabalhos que pode ser mostrado a potenciais empregadores ou clientes. Isso demonstra suas habilidades de programação e seu comprometimento em aprender e desenvolver projetos práticos.

10 Projetos Em Python para Iniciantes Aprenderem e Praticarem:

Aprender a programar em Python é uma jornada emocionante, e a melhor forma de consolidar os conhecimentos adquiridos é através da prática. Ao realizar projetos em Python, você estará aplicando os conceitos que aprendeu de forma prática e desafiadora. Aqui estão alguns projetos recomendados para iniciantes que desejam aprimorar suas habilidades em Python:

1. Jogo da Forca

Crie um jogo da forca em Python, onde o jogador tenta adivinhar uma palavra oculta, tendo um número limitado de tentativas.

2. Calculadora

Desenvolva uma calculadora simples em Python, capaz de realizar operações básicas como adição, subtração, multiplicação e divisão.

3. Gerador de senhas

Crie um programa que gere senhas aleatórias e seguras, levando em consideração critérios como comprimento e uso de caracteres especiais.

4. Conversor de unidades

Desenvolva um programa que converta unidades de medida, como quilômetros para milhas, Celsius para Fahrenheit, entre outras.

5. Jogo da Velha

Crie o clássico jogo da velha em Python, onde dois jogadores podem competir entre si.

6. Gerenciador de tarefas

Desenvolva um programa que ajude a gerenciar tarefas, permitindo adicionar, remover e visualizar tarefas pendentes.

7. Analisador de texto

Crie um programa que analise um texto fornecido pelo usuário e forneça informações como número de palavras, caracteres e frequência de palavras.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

8. Simulador de dados

Desenvolva um programa que simule o lançamento de dados, permitindo ao usuário escolher o número de dados e o número de lançamentos.

9. Agenda telefônica

Crie um programa que armazene contatos em uma agenda telefônica, permitindo adicionar, remover e pesquisar contatos.

10. Gerador de gráficos

Desenvolva um programa que gere gráficos a partir de dados fornecidos pelo usuário, permitindo visualizar informações de forma visualmente atraente.

Esses são apenas alguns exemplos de projetos em Python para iniciantes. Lembre-se de escolher projetos que despertem seu interesse e desafiem suas habilidades. À medida que você desenvolve esses projetos, lembre-se de buscar soluções criativas e de pesquisar recursos adicionais para expandir seus conhecimentos. Praticar regularmente e enfrentar desafios é a chave para aprimorar suas habilidades em programação Python.

Dicas para se aprimorar na programação Python:

A programação Python é uma habilidade valiosa e versátil, e existem várias maneiras de aprimorar suas habilidades e se tornar um programador Python mais competente. Aqui estão algumas dicas úteis para impulsionar seu progresso na programação Python:

  • Pratique regularmente
  • Participe de projetos de código aberto
  • Explore a comunidade Python
  • Leia e estude código Python existente
  • Faça cursos e tutoriais online
  • Colabore com outros desenvolvedores
  • Mantenha-se atualizado
  • Pratique a resolução de problemas

Ao seguir essas dicas e se dedicar ao aprendizado e prática da programação Python, você estará no caminho certo para se tornar um programador Python habilidoso e confiante. Lembre-se de que o aprendizado é um processo contínuo e que a perseverança e a paixão pela programação serão seus maiores aliados nessa jornada.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ada

Aprenda uma nova língua na maior escola de idioma do mundo!

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a.

+ 400 mil alunos

Método validado

Aulas

Ao vivo e gravadas

+ 1000 horas

Duração dos cursos

Certificados

Reconhecido pelo mercado

Quero estudar na Fluency

Sobre o autor

A melhor plataforma para aprender tecnologia no Brasil

A fluency skills é a melhor maneira de aprender tecnologia no Brasil.
Faça parte e tenha acesso a cursos e mentorias individuais com os melhores profissionais do mercado.